Laura Klünder
|
bbfa6ac8c1
|
fix prefetch_related again
|
2017-06-13 22:32:58 +02:00 |
|
Laura Klünder
|
38baebb536
|
don't break prefetch_related
|
2017-06-13 22:07:36 +02:00 |
|
Laura Klünder
|
3e36f5b7a3
|
fix comparing wrapped model instances
|
2017-06-13 18:58:48 +02:00 |
|
Laura Klünder
|
e3c8947883
|
do creepy metaclass stuff in wrappers.py
|
2017-06-13 18:52:16 +02:00 |
|
Laura Klünder
|
da9a7c5130
|
instances of queryset should also be wrapped
|
2017-06-13 17:40:35 +02:00 |
|
Laura Klünder
|
3609420d8e
|
implement BaseQueryWrapper.prefetch_related
|
2017-06-13 17:03:16 +02:00 |
|
Laura Klünder
|
2ae30613dc
|
exclude deleted existing objects according to changes
|
2017-06-13 16:36:18 +02:00 |
|
Laura Klünder
|
18174c373a
|
call _parse_change in _new_change
|
2017-06-13 16:25:01 +02:00 |
|
Laura Klünder
|
c07a2f1ab5
|
remove debug output
|
2017-06-13 16:24:41 +02:00 |
|
Laura Klünder
|
ef5764305f
|
ChangeSet: call parse_change only when needed
|
2017-06-13 16:22:59 +02:00 |
|
Laura Klünder
|
164fe5d892
|
update wrapped models according to changeset
|
2017-06-13 16:15:28 +02:00 |
|
Laura Klünder
|
fb91af07e0
|
dont pushState onpopstate
|
2017-06-13 15:39:06 +02:00 |
|
Laura Klünder
|
9fb248d35d
|
tread header changeset link as sidebar link
|
2017-06-13 15:35:20 +02:00 |
|
Laura Klünder
|
4cae5252de
|
show or delete current changeset
|
2017-06-13 15:31:54 +02:00 |
|
Laura Klünder
|
cba7feb29f
|
ManyRelatedManagerWrapper.set() should propagate author
|
2017-06-13 14:49:57 +02:00 |
|
Laura Klünder
|
18cf51dfbd
|
fix minor python linter issues
|
2017-06-13 14:49:20 +02:00 |
|
Laura Klünder
|
551cc15f14
|
add ChangeSet.qs_for_request
|
2017-06-13 14:42:08 +02:00 |
|
Laura Klünder
|
ff0922fe64
|
track m2m changes
|
2017-06-13 14:21:01 +02:00 |
|
Laura Klünder
|
66596aac63
|
fix ModelInstanceWrapper foreignkey values
|
2017-06-13 13:03:36 +02:00 |
|
Laura Klünder
|
4e1469c7d4
|
use author of ModelInstanceWrapper if not missing in save or delete call
|
2017-06-13 03:39:52 +02:00 |
|
Laura Klünder
|
b062e76b7a
|
track object deletion
|
2017-06-13 03:39:12 +02:00 |
|
Laura Klünder
|
e84028ffa8
|
create changes on wrapped model save
|
2017-06-13 03:31:10 +02:00 |
|
Laura Klünder
|
4269f64326
|
remove DIRECT_EDITING setting
|
2017-06-13 00:13:10 +02:00 |
|
Laura Klünder
|
2f0b7d13d6
|
fix form validation on ModelMultipleChoiceField
|
2017-06-13 00:12:55 +02:00 |
|
Laura Klünder
|
2739132019
|
isort
|
2017-06-12 23:45:08 +02:00 |
|
Laura Klünder
|
344ab790a3
|
wrap around ORM in editor api
|
2017-06-12 23:33:59 +02:00 |
|
Laura Klünder
|
7e78bf0550
|
wrap around entire django ORM in all editor views
|
2017-06-12 22:56:39 +02:00 |
|
Laura Klünder
|
9e58a662e0
|
rename Change.object to Change.obj
|
2017-06-12 18:29:21 +02:00 |
|
Laura Klünder
|
ad568fdc0b
|
fix Change.clean() regarding creation
|
2017-06-12 18:26:24 +02:00 |
|
Laura Klünder
|
64fac50f77
|
change author can also be null
|
2017-06-12 18:15:45 +02:00 |
|
Laura Klünder
|
cf4ad3dcae
|
fix sticky submit buttons
|
2017-06-12 18:12:43 +02:00 |
|
Laura Klünder
|
8000c00e2a
|
editor: check for duplicate redirect slugs with a single query
|
2017-06-12 18:02:40 +02:00 |
|
Laura Klünder
|
f55ea561bd
|
get changeset for session/user and show it in ediutr in top right corner
|
2017-06-12 17:22:38 +02:00 |
|
Laura Klünder
|
172189a90b
|
ChangeSet author can be null
|
2017-06-12 16:59:57 +02:00 |
|
Laura Klünder
|
2770628315
|
move editor noscript message
|
2017-06-12 15:51:20 +02:00 |
|
Laura Klünder
|
2fccf4222d
|
move responsive switch to subheader
|
2017-06-12 15:39:56 +02:00 |
|
Laura Klünder
|
88330bbfeb
|
disallow delete
|
2017-06-12 15:16:17 +02:00 |
|
Laura Klünder
|
fe0c2a1b48
|
save should raise TypeError is saving is not allowed
|
2017-06-12 15:07:42 +02:00 |
|
Laura Klünder
|
b4c640254f
|
dont add changes to finished changesets
|
2017-06-12 15:06:51 +02:00 |
|
Laura Klünder
|
7f4c917872
|
add missing self
|
2017-06-12 15:06:42 +02:00 |
|
Laura Klünder
|
690785fd4d
|
call full_clean on change object save
|
2017-06-12 15:01:36 +02:00 |
|
Laura Klünder
|
17e965e26e
|
change objects can not be edited
|
2017-06-12 14:59:56 +02:00 |
|
Laura Klünder
|
bd7c8161d6
|
coplete Change model for editor
|
2017-06-12 14:52:08 +02:00 |
|
Laura Klünder
|
ee34d16b67
|
create models Change and ChangeSet for editor
|
2017-06-12 13:20:26 +02:00 |
|
Laura Klünder
|
845cce3cc2
|
check migrations in .travis.yml
|
2017-06-11 16:24:58 +02:00 |
|
Laura Klünder
|
1a30cb325e
|
improve queries in editor views
|
2017-06-11 15:37:25 +02:00 |
|
Laura Klünder
|
61fa8276b2
|
remove invalid h3 tag
|
2017-06-11 15:24:52 +02:00 |
|
Laura Klünder
|
e8ffe20413
|
optimize queries in mapdata API
|
2017-06-11 15:10:48 +02:00 |
|
Laura Klünder
|
1498b7aeb0
|
rename Section back to Level
|
2017-06-11 14:43:14 +02:00 |
|
Laura Klünder
|
27ff35e785
|
remove old attribute in html
|
2017-06-11 13:53:48 +02:00 |
|